What is sermorelin?
Sermorelin is a fragment of growth hormone releasing hormone, the first 29 amino acids of the natural 44 amino acid molecule, which is enough to bind the GHRH receptor and trigger the pituitary to release its own growth hormone. It was FDA approved under the brand name Geref for diagnosing and treating growth hormone deficiency before that product was discontinued. It is now mainly available through compounding pharmacies for off label use.
